The fuel for heating is the air
Heat pumps extract heat from ambient air and concentrate it into hot water, process heat or cooling. In the tropical Philippines the air is already warm — the work the heat pump has to do is minimal. That is why R290 systems deliver COP 4.0–5.0 in real Philippine conditions, while the same equipment in Europe struggles below COP 3.0 in winter. Tropical climate, premium efficiency.

What is an R290 heat pump?
An R290 heat pump uses propane as a natural refrigerant to transfer heat from the air to water. R290 has a Global Warming Potential (GWP) of just 3 — over 700x lower than legacy HFC refrigerants — and achieves COP ratings of 4.0-5.0.
What are natural refrigerants?
Natural refrigerants include R290 (propane) and CO₂ (R744). They have near-zero global warming potential, are not affected by PFAS bans or HFC phase-downs, and deliver superior efficiency with COP ratings of 4.0-5.0.
What is the difference between R290 and CO₂ refrigerants?
R290 (propane) has a GWP of 3 and excels in heating applications with COP 4.0-5.0. CO₂ (R744) has a GWP of 1, is non-flammable, and is ideal for refrigeration and cooling down to -40°C. Both are natural, PFAS-free, and future-proof against regulatory changes.
Is R290 refrigerant safe?
Yes. R290 (propane) is classified as non-toxic with an A3 safety rating. Modern R290 heat pumps use very small refrigerant charges (under 1kg) in sealed outdoor units, meeting all international safety standards including IEC 60335-2-40.
What does COP mean?
COP stands for Coefficient of Performance. A COP of 4.0 means for every 1 kW of electricity consumed, the heat pump produces 4 kW of heat. Higher COP means greater efficiency and lower running costs. Karnot iHEAT systems achieve COP 4.0-5.0.
